Cursos de SQL ¿Alguna vez te has preguntado cómo las grandes empresas gestionan millones de datos? ¿Cómo Amazon organiza la inmensa cantidad de información sobre productos, clientes y transacciones?
En los últimos años, el manejo de bases de datos se ha convertido en una de las habilidades más valoradas, especialmente para profesionales del sector tecnológico, marketing, finanzas, recursos humanos, y prácticamente en cualquier área donde se manipule información. Y no sólo porque permite manejar bases de datos, sino también tomar decisiones basadas en datos, optimizar procesos y aportar valor a cualquier empresa.
Por este motivo, aprender SQL (Structured Query Language) puede abrirte las puertas a numerosas oportunidades laborales, ayudándote a entender mejor cómo se estructura, maneja y optimiza la información en diferentes sectores.
Algunos de los cursos de SQL con Datacamp
Fundamentos de S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Introducción a S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
SQL intermedio (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Unión de datos en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Manipulación de datos en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Análisis Exploratorio de Datos en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Diseño de bases de datos (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Introducción a las bases de datos relacionales en SQ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Funciones para manipular datos en PostgreSQL (Datacamp)
Al ser partners oficiales de Datacamp si compras desde este enlace puedes llevarte descuentos, cursos, guías, y Ebooks.
Somos partners oficiales de estas escuelas. Con nosotros podrás obtener beneficios y descuentos.
Mira lo que opinan antiguos alumnos
00
Proyectos
00
Leads
00
Cualificación
00
Conversiones
¿Qué es SQL y para qué sirve?
SQL, o Structured Query Language, es un lenguaje de programación que se utiliza para gestionar y manipular bases de datos relacionales, que son sistemas diseñados para almacenar datos en tablas estructuradas. Permitiendo crear, leer, actualizar y eliminar datos.
Las tablas se encuentran organizadas en filas y columnas, facilitando la organización y recuperación de la información. SQL permite a los usuarios realizar operaciones sobre estas tablas, como filtrar datos, realizar cálculos y combinar información de distintas tablas.
Una de las mayores ventajas de SQL es su estructura declarativa, permitiendo describir lo que queremos lograr y que sea el propio sistema el que se encargue de determinar la mejor manera de hacerlo. Lo que hace que resulte sencillo incluso para aquellos que no tienen una experiencia previa en programación.
¿Características de SQL?
SQL presenta una serie de características que lo convierten en una herramienta muy potente y flexible para trabajar con bases de datos, facilitando enormemente la realización de tareas complejas.
- Estándar del lenguaje. SQL es un estándar de la industria, siendo usado en una gran variedad de sistemas de bases de datos, como MySQL, PostgreSQL, Oracle y Microsoft SQL Server. Esto quiere decir que las habilidades de SQL pueden ser transferibles entre diferentes sistemas, facilitando el trabajo a aquellos profesionales que trabajan en entornos diversos.
- Independencia de la plataforma. Otra característica importante de SQL es su independencia de la plataforma. No importa si estás trabajando en Windows, Linux o cualquier otro sistema operativo, SQL funcionará de la misma manera. Esto lo hace extremadamente versátil, pudiendo ser usado prácticamente cualquier entorno de trabajo.
- Potencia y flexibilidad. SQL es tan potente como flexible. Puedes usarlo para realizar tareas sencillas, como recuperar una lista de clientes, o para llevar a cabo operaciones más complejas, como análisis de datos y creación de informes. Además, SQL permite la integración con otros lenguajes de programación, como Python y R, lo que amplía aún más sus capacidades.
Funcionalidades de SQL
SQL ofrece una amplia gama de funcionalidades que lo hacen indispensable para la gestión de bases de datos, tanto para interactuar con los datos como para manipular y analizar la información.
- Consultas y manipulación de datos. Una de las principales funcionalidades de SQL es su capacidad de realizar consultas y manipular datos. Gracias a ello, podemos extraer datos específicos de una base de datos, actualizar información existente, eliminar datos que ya no son necesarios, etc. De esta forma, podemos mantener nuestras bases de datos siempre actualizadas y optimizadas.
- Creación y gestión de bases de datos. SQL también permite la creación y gestión de bases de datos, pudiendo crear nuevas bases de datos, definir las estructuras de las tablas, establecer relaciones entre tabla, etc. Gracias a ello, podemos tener un control total sobre cómo se organizan y almacenan los datos, garantizando así la integridad y el rendimiento de las bases de datos.
- Control de acceso y seguridad. SQL nos permite definir quién tiene acceso a qué datos para que la información sensible quede protegida. Podemos establecer permisos para diferentes usuarios y roles, lo que nos permite controlar quién puede ver, modificar o eliminar datos en la base de datos.
- Transacciones y recuperación de datos. SQL también ofrece soporte para transacciones, lo que significa que podemos realizar múltiples operaciones como una única unidad de trabajo. Esto es fundamental para garantizar la consistencia de los datos, especialmente en situaciones en las que es necesario completar varias operaciones juntas. Además, SQL ofrece funcionalidades de recuperación de datos, por lo que, en caso de fallos o errores, podemos restaurar la información.
Cursos de SQL | ¿Por qué aprender SQL?
En un mundo donde el “Big Data” y el análisis de datos son cada vez más importantes, SQL se ha convertido en una competencia básica para analistas, desarrolladores, científicos de datos y muchos otros profesionales.
SQL es el lenguaje estándar para interactuar con bases de datos relacionales, por lo que es fundamental para cualquier persona que trabaje con datos. Gracias a ello, no sólo podrás acceder a mejores oportunidades laborales, sino que, además, te dará un control total sobre los datos, pudiendo crear, leer, actualizar y eliminar información en bases de datos de manera eficiente. Con el añadido de que los conocimientos adquiridos son aplicables en casi cualquier entorno, desde MySQL y PostgreSQL hasta Oracle y Microsoft SQL Server.
Pero además, te volverás más autosuficiente en tu trabajo. No dependerás de otros para obtener la información que necesitas, lo que, además de suponer un gran ahorro de tiempo, también te permite presentar valiosos informes basados en datos, lo que puede ser determinante a la hora de tomar decisiones estratégicas.
Salidas profesionales si aprendes SQL
SQL no solo es una herramienta clave para desarrolladores y administradores de bases de datos, sino que, además, su aplicación puede extenderse a numerosos roles y sectores. En este sentido, algunas de las principales salidas profesionales son las siguientes:
- Analista de datos. Los analistas de datos utilizan SQL para extraer, analizar y reportar datos. Un puesto esencial para realizar consultas que permitan entender el comportamiento de los usuarios, optimizar campañas de marketing o mejorar la productividad de la empresa.
- Desarrollador de bases de datos. Los desarrolladores de bases de datos se ocupan de diseñar, implementar y mantener sistemas de bases de datos. Crean y gestionan estructuras complejas de datos, garantizando la integridad y el rendimiento del sistema. Además, se encargan de optimizar las consultas para asegurar que las bases de datos respondan de manera eficiente a las necesidades de la empresa.
- Científico de datos. Los científicos de datos utilizan SQL para acceder a grandes volúmenes de datos y realizar análisis estadísticos y predictivos. En combinación con otras herramientas y lenguajes, como Python y R, SQL permite a estos profesionales desarrollar modelos que pueden prever tendencias, identificar patrones y ofrecer recomendaciones basadas en datos.
- Ingeniero de datos. Los ingenieros de datos se encargan de construir y mantener las infraestructuras de datos que soportan las operaciones y el análisis de datos en una empresa. Diseñan y gestionan flujos de datos, garantizando que la información fluya de manera eficiente y esté disponible para los usuarios que la necesiten. Para ello, se requieren, además, habilidades en otras áreas técnicas como la programación y la administración de sistemas.
- Especialista en marketing digital. Aunque no es una salida profesional tan obvia, los especialistas en marketing digital también se benefician enormemente de los conocimientos en SQL. Gracias a ello, pueden extraer datos directamente de las bases de datos de la empresa para analizar el rendimiento de campañas, segmentar audiencias o realizar pruebas A/B, lo que puede ayudar a mejorar considerablemente los resultados de las campañas.
Cursos de SQL | Beneficios de estudiar SQL
Estudiar SQL no solo abre puertas a diversas oportunidades laborales, sino que, además, ofrece una serie de beneficios que pueden ayudar a mejorar tu carrera profesional:
- Mentalidad orientada a los datos. SQL ayuda a desarrollar una mentalidad orientada a los datos, lo que quiere decir que empezarás a ver los problemas y las soluciones desde una perspectiva basada en la información. De esta forma, podrás analizar grandes volúmenes de datos, identificar patrones y tendencias, y utilizar esta información para tomar mejores decisiones.
- Eficiencia en la resolución de problemas. SQL permite resolver problemas de manera más rápida y eficiente. Al poder consultar bases de datos directamente, podemos obtener la información que necesitamos sin depender de nadie, lo que nos confiere un control total sobre el proceso de análisis.
- Colaboración interdepartamental. En muchas empresas, los equipos de TI y de negocio, muchas veces, tienen dificultades para comunicarse. Al aprender SQL, te convertirás en un puente entre estos dos mundos, pudiendo hablar el idioma de los técnicos y, al mismo tiempo, entender las necesidades del negocio, facilitando la colaboración y asegurándote de que todo el mundo esté alineado con los mismos objetivos y estrategias.
Aplicaciones prácticas de SQL
SQL es una herramienta extremadamente versátil que puede aplicarse en una amplia variedad de situaciones.
- Gestión de inventarios. Una de las aplicaciones más comunes de SQL es en la gestión de inventarios. Las empresas que manejan grandes cantidades de productos necesitan encontrar una manera nos muestren qué productos se están vendiendo más, cuáles tienen un inventario más bajo y cuáles nos están generando mayores márgenes de beneficio. De esta forma, podemos tener más claro qué productos comprar, cuándo hacerlo y en qué cantidades.
- Análisis de clientes. SQL también es extremadamente útil para realizar análisis de clientes. Podemos segmentarlos en base a diferentes perfiles, teniendo en cuenta su historial de compras, su comportamiento de navegación o su ubicación geográfica. Gracias a ello, podemos personalizar nuestras campañas de marketing y mejorar la experiencia del cliente, lo que puede contribuir a una mayor fidelización.
- Reportes financieros. Con SQL, también podemos crear consultas que nos proporcionen un panorama más claro de la situación financiera de la empresa, desde el flujo de caja hasta el rendimiento de las inversiones. Informes que pueden ser utilizados por el equipo directivo para tomar decisiones sobre el futuro de la empresa.